To be honest you don't need this guide. I will give you one:

1) Start on Hard (Its unlocked from beginning.)

2) Beat each level. Each Level is worth a Gold Trophy. Just beat them for each gold trophy. 10 Levels mean 10 Gold Trophies.

3) Since you played it on "Hard" you have all trophies in
one play (About 4 Hours).

4) Platinum Time. Since you played "Hard" and beat the levels.
